Chocolate Cake Pops

Decadent Chocolate Cake Pops That Everyone Will Love

Chocolate Cake Pops are a delightful and easy-to-make dessert that everyone will love. Perfect for any occasion!
Prep Time 1 hour
Cook Time 30 minutes
Chilling Time 45 minutes
Total Time 2 hours 15 minutes
Servings: 24 cake pops
Course: Desserts
Cuisine: American
Calories: 150

Ingredients
  

For the Cake
  • 15 oz Chocolate Cake Mix
  • 3 Eggs As per package instructions
  • 0.5 cup Vegetable Oil Adds moisture
  • 1 cup Water Substituting with milk is recommended
For the Coating
  • 12 oz Chocolate Melting Wafers Candy wafers yield the best results
  • 1 cup Sprinkles Optional decoration
For the Frosting
  • 0.5 cup Salted Butter Softened to room temperature
  • 8 oz Plain Cream Cheese Softened for easy blending
  • 1 tsp Vanilla Extract Use high-quality extract
  • 2 cup Powdered Sugar Sifted for a smooth mix

Equipment

  • mixing bowl
  • baking pan
  • Parchment Paper
  • microwave-safe bowl
  • Stand mixer

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a baking pan. Combine the chocolate cake mix, eggs, oil, and water (or milk) in a large bowl.
  2. Pour the batter into the prepared pan and bake for approximately 30 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ean. Cool completely on a wire rack.
  3. Prepare the frosting by mixing the softened butter, cream cheese, vanilla, and powdered sugar in a bowl until light and fluffy, about 3-5 minutes.
  4. Crumble the cooled cake into fine crumbs in a large bowl. Mix in about 1 cup of cream cheese frosting until well combined.
  5. Chill the mixture in the refrigerator for about 30-45 minutes to firm it up.
  6. Roll about 1.5 tablespoons of the chilled mixture into balls and place them on a parchment-lined baking sheet.
  7. Melt the chocolate melting wafers in a microwave-safe bowl in 30-second intervals until smooth.
  8. Dip the tip of each cake pop stick into the melted chocolate, then insert into the center of each cake ball.
  9. Chill the cake pops until the chocolate is set, about 30-45 minutes.
  10. Dip each cake pop into the melted chocolate, tapping off excess chocolate, and place back on the parchment paper.
  11. Add sprinkles on top while the chocolate is still wet, then allow to set at room temperature.
  12. Once set, serve your chocolate cake pops or store them in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 7 days.
